WebJan 27, 2024 · Billings, Mont.-based First Interstate BancSystem Inc., the parent company of First Interstate Bank, will launch changes to its consumer overdraft practices, effective April 1. Those changes include the elimination of nonsufficient fund charges and a 67% reduction in overdraft fees to $10 from $30.
